Methodology & data sources
What this is. A near-real-time nowcast of US private-capital formation, built from SEC Form D filings. Issuers raising capital in exempt offerings (Reg D 506(b)/506(c), Reg D 504) must file a Form D within 15 days of first sale, so the monthly filing count tracks fresh private-fundraising activity — venture, growth, real-estate syndications, private funds and operating companies alike.
The feed. We query EDGAR full-text search (efts.sec.gov/LATEST/search-index?forms=D) once per calendar month; the response's hits.total.value is the filing count. Counts include Form D and D/A (amendments), so they measure filing activity rather than unique new offerings — month-over-month change is the signal, not the absolute level.
Coverage & honesty. The volume and momentum series are fully live. Sector, offering size and fund-vs-operating-company splits live inside each Form D's XML (Items 4, 13) and are a documented fast-follow — the refresh script can fan out to the per-filing XML to populate them. We do not estimate or fabricate a sector breakdown here.
Cadence. Refresh weekly; the partial current month is extrapolated only for the labelled run-rate stat, never written into the historical bars.
